What is the SBA $10,000 grant?

It's important to clarify that SBA loans are not grants; they are loans that require repayment. While there isn't a specific $10,000 SBA grant program, various federal and state grant opportunities may exist for Alabama businesses. What does an SBA loan mean?

An SBA loan means the U.S. Small Business Administration partially guarantees the loan, reducing the risk for lenders. This can make it easier for businesses in Alabama, including those in Birmingham, to secure capital with potentially more favorable terms and repayment schedules than traditional loans.

What is an SBA loan?

An SBA loan is a business loan that is partially guaranteed by the Small Business Administration. This government backing encourages banks and other lenders to provide capital to small businesses that might otherwise struggle to qualify for conventional financing.
